The Bullwhip Effect and How to Prevent It

SupplyPike

Learn about: What the “bullwhip effect” is How it affects your supply chain How to prevent it. What will happen if a person who is holding a long whip gives it a little jolt at the handgrip? A motion will be initiated in the area near the handgrip. This motion will keep on increasing as we go towards the other end of the whip, with it being minimal at the handgrip.

Machine Vision system (the eye of the machine)

Prophetic Technology

How does Machine Vision work? Software and hardware combined work to make MV systems possible. The purpose of all its capabilities is to grant machines the power of vision aiming to imitate human sight. But devices need to go through the process of acquiring, analysing and understanding images.

Print on Demand: An Earth-Friendly Printing Strategy

Amware Logistics and Fulfillment

Decades ago, futurists predicted that widespread use of computers would usher in a paperless society. They were wrong. In this digital age, businesses still use some 21 million tons of paper each year, and 50 percent of all business waste is paper.

Veoneer Focuses on Growing their Business with QAD

QAD

Today’s cars are undergoing changes as dramatic as anything in their century-plus history. Electrification is coming, hand-in-hand with autonomous driving capabilities. Automakers are developing some of these capabilities themselves but others, especially in the self-driving realm, are being pushed by companies like Veoneer. Spun off from auto parts giant Autoliv in 2018, Veoneer is a leader in both passive and active safety technology.
